The scope of legal protection for listed buildings
This List entry helps identify the building designated at this address for its special architectural or historic interest.
Unless the List entry states otherwise, it includes both the structure itself and any object or structure fixed to it (whether inside or outside) as well as any object or structure within the curtilage of the building.
For these purposes, to be included within the curtilage of the building, the object or structure must have formed part of the land since before 1st July 1948.

Details
WORCESTER
SO8554SW DIGLIS ROAD
620-1/20/214 (East side)
18/02/99 Nos.11-17 (Odd)
II
Terrace of 4 houses. c1850, in 2 stages of build, pair to left
are lower, and with later additions and alterations. Brick in
Flemish bond with stuccoed arches to right, stucco over brick
to left, with slate roofs where original. Party wall brick
stacks to front and rear to left pair; party wall and end
stacks to right pair; all with oversailing courses and some
retaining pots. 2 storeys, 2:2:3:3 first-floor windows.
First-floor: blind window, two 8/8 sashes, blind opening; to
right pair are 6/6 sashes, those to centre of each house are
narrower. Ground-floor: two 8/8 sashes, then 6/6 sashes; all
windows in plain reveals and with sills, those to right pair
have flat voussoir arches and keystones. Entrances: outer
entrances to left pair of houses: flush panelled doors with
overlights with marginal glazing bars and hoods, in plain
reveals. Central entrances to pair to right. 6-panel door in
pilastered surround with pediment; and 4
raised-and-fielded-panel door with fanlight with radial
glazing bars and pilastered surround with open pediment.
INTERIORS: not inspected.
